| #ifndef GEOMETRY_TEST_COMMON_WITH_POINTER_HPP |
| #define GEOMETRY_TEST_COMMON_WITH_POINTER_HPP |
| |
| |
| #include <boost/geometry/core/access.hpp> |
| #include <boost/geometry/core/coordinate_type.hpp> |
| #include <boost/geometry/core/coordinate_system.hpp> |
| #include <boost/geometry/core/coordinate_dimension.hpp> |
| #include <boost/geometry/core/cs.hpp> |
| #include <boost/geometry/core/tag.hpp> |
| |
| |
| namespace test |
| { |
| |
| // Sample point, having x/y |
| struct test_point_xy |
| { |
| float x,y; |
| }; |
| |
| } |
| |
| |
| namespace boost { namespace geometry { namespace traits { |
| |
| template<> struct tag<test::test_point_xy*> |
| { typedef point_tag type; }; |
| |
| template<> struct coordinate_type<test::test_point_xy*> |
| { typedef double type; }; |
| |
| template<> struct coordinate_system<test::test_point_xy*> |
| { typedef cs::cartesian type; }; |
| |
| template<> struct dimension<test::test_point_xy*> : boost::mpl::int_<2> {}; |
| |
| template<> |
| struct access<test::test_point_xy*, 0> |
| { |
| static double get(test::test_point_xy const* p) |
| { |
| return p->x; |
| } |
| |
| static void set(test::test_point_xy* p, double const& value) |
| { |
| p->x = value; |
| } |
| |
| }; |
| |
| |
| template<> |
| struct access<test::test_point_xy*, 1> |
| { |
| static double get(test::test_point_xy const* p) |
| { |
| return p->y; |
| } |
| |
| static void set(test::test_point_xy* p, double const& value) |
| { |
| p->y = value; |
| } |
| |
| }; |
| |
| }}} // namespace bg::traits |
| |
| |
| #endif // #ifndef GEOMETRY_TEST_COMMON_WITH_POINTER_HPP |
